Production Manager
The Production Manager will be responsible for overseeing, coordinating, and managing the end-to-end manufacturing process of pre-insulated pipes, fabricated components, and coated products. This role ensures production targets are met in terms of quality, cost, delivery, safety, and efficiency, while leading continuous improvement initiatives across operations. Key Responsibilities Production Planning & Control: • Develop and execute daily, weekly, and monthly production schedules aligned with project timelines. • Allocate manpower, materials, and equipment effectively to maximize output and minimize downtime. • Provide inputs to the production planning process and thereafter ensure that production targets/plans are met and there is optimum utilization of all resources; work force, machines and material. • Monitor the utilization of machines and manpower, ensures reduction of downtime through efficient maintenance (both breakdown as well as preventive) and keeps a check/control on the rejection rates Operational Management: • Supervise fabrication, insulation, and coating operations ensuring compliance with technical specifications and standards (e.g., ISO, ASTM, Aramco specs). • Monitor production performance (KPIs) — efficiency, yield, wastage, and lead times. • Coordinate closely with QA/QC, Maintenance, and Procurement to ensure smooth workflow. • Test & Monitor plant processes • Remain in compliance with facility IMS standards and all HSE guidelines • Prepare, analyze and issue production and performance reports • Ensure safety and efficiency of the facility Quality & Compliance: • Enforce adherence to quality, health, safety, and environmental policies (QHSE). • Oversee inspections for coating thickness, insulation integrity, and fabrication accuracy. • Drive root cause analysis and corrective/preventive actions for non-conformities. People & Resource Management: • Lead and mentor a team of supervisors, technicians, and operators. • Evaluate training needs and promote skill enhancement. • Manage shift rosters and ensure discipline and productivity among team members. Continuous Improvement: • Identify cost-saving opportunities, optimize production layouts, and introduce lean manufacturing practices. • Implement best practices in pre-insulated and coated pipe manufacturing processes. • Carry out periodical capacity study to insure plant capability to handle production requirements and recommend necessary capital expenditure • Monitor operational expenses, materials usage and Losses and overall unit cost to insure efficient resources utilization and to initiate corrective actions as required • Implement operational control and continual improvement in order to achieve organizational goal. • Establish best industrial practices to ensure safety of the workplace and environment is followed at outmost priority. Coordination & Reporting: • Liaise with Project, Planning, Procurement, and QC teams for material planning and dispatch scheduling. • Prepare and present regular production reports, variance analyses, and improvement proposals. Accountabilities: • Achievement of production targets and delivery deadlines. • Product quality and rejection rates. • Safety compliance and incident-free operations. • Process improvement achievements and cost savings.
• Bachelor’s Degree in Mechanical, Industrial, or Manufacturing Engineering (or equivalent) • 5+ year’s experience, preferably in a similar position in manufacturing company • Fluent English • Ability to communicate in regional language as per the working locale / region is preferred • Driving license, preferred • ERP, MS Office • Strong understanding of pre-insulation processes (PUF, HDPE jacketing, jointing). • Experience with epoxy, polyethylene, or FBE coating lines. • Familiarity with fabrication drawings, welding procedures, and NDT processes.
